chiark / gitweb /
@@ -1,3 +1,22 @@
[userv.git] / debian / initd
1 #!/bin/sh
2
3 test -f /usr/sbin/uservd || exit 0
4
5 case "$1" in
6 start)
7         echo -n "Starting user services daemon: uservd"
8         start-stop-daemon --start --quiet --exec /usr/sbin/uservd -- -daemon
9         echo "."
10         ;;
11
12 stop)
13         echo -n "Stopping user services daemon: uservd"
14         start-stop-daemon --stop --quiet --user root --exec /usr/sbin/uservd
15         echo "."
16         ;;
17
18 restart)
19         echo -n "Restarting user services daemon: uservd"
20         start-stop-daemon --stop --oknodo --quiet --user root \
21                 --exec /usr/sbin/uservd
22         sleep 1
23         start-stop-daemon --start --quiet --exec /usr/sbin/uservd -- -daemon
24         echo "."
25         ;;
26
27 reload | force-reload)
28         ;;
29 *)
30         echo "Usage: /etc/init.d/userv {start|stop|restart|reload|force-reload}"
31         exit 1
32 esac
33
34 exit 0